Abstract
The following article shows the significant advances that have been made in research on the acquisition of mathematical competencies, clarifying the research problem, the research rationale and the different methodological aspects of the research to be carried out. In this sense, taking into account Hurtado (2010), the research approach will be based on the Holistic Comprehension of Science, on the Holopraxic Method (Holistic spiral) and on a Projective type of Research.
The theoretical support of competencies in general and mathematical competencies will focus nthe following authors: De Zubiría (2006, 2014), Tobón et al (2006), Tobón (2013), Perrenoud (2012), Romero (2019), D’amore et al (2008) y Solar et al (2014). These researchers indicate how competencies should be worked on, and the way in which different thoughts are articulated to obtain a broad and integrative comprehension of mathematical competencies, based on the three dimensions /synergies) of competencies (cognitive, socio-affective and praxical). Therefore, by being able to integrate the different elements, characteristics, factors and associated conditions that are present in the formation process (teaching, learning and evaluation), it will be possible to design a proposal from a holistic and integral perspective for the acquisition of mathematical competencies.
In short, the purpose of the proposal to be designed is to enable ninth grade students in rural áreas of educational institutions under the agricultural and livestock modality to be mathematically competent and to solve problems in their environment and context, based on the application of the different mathematical competencies that they acquire and develop in the learning environment.
